Lights out for 46th Street tenants
Tenants of three Sunset Park buildings held an emergency rent strike rally in front of Assemblymember Felix Ortizs office on July 9, after living for years with spotty electricity, heat and hot water.
In the summer, the lights go off every 20 minutes or so. In the winter, there is no heat or hot water, said Sara Lopez, head of the tenants association of the three attached buildings at 454, 553 and 557 46th Street. There are lots of children living here and people who are sick. In the winter, we have to use space heaters, so at nighttime, it can be dangerous.
When fire marshals were called to the building a few weeks ago after a power outage which residents say happens multiple times a day they found a small plastic fan cooling off the fuse box.
